Cauliflower Crust Pizza with Turkey Pepperoni
Enjoy a delicious twist on pizza with a crispy cauliflower crust topped with a savory tomato sauce, melty low-fat cheese, and turkey pepperoni slices. This recipe offers a satisfying balance of textures and a flavorful blend of ingredients that make it perfect for a healthy dinner option.
INGREDIENTS
1 cup Cauliflower (107g)
2 large Eggs (100g)
1 ounce Low-Fat Mozzarella Cheese (28g)
60 grams Turkey Pepperoni
1/4 cup Tomato Sauce (60g)
1 tbsp Fresh Basil
Salt and Pepper to taste
PREPARATION
Preheat your oven to 425°F (220°C) and line a baking sheet with parchment paper.
Steam or microwave the cauliflower until softened, then place in a bowl and mash or pulse in a food processor until it resembles rice.
Transfer the cauliflower to a microwave-safe bowl, cover, and microwave for 4-5 minutes until tender. Let it cool slightly.
Mix the cauliflower with the eggs, low-fat mozzarella cheese, salt, and pepper until well combined.
Spread the mixture onto the prepared baking sheet, forming a thin, even circular crust.
Bake the crust in the preheated oven for about 15 minutes until it begins to turn golden and set.
Remove the crust from the oven and spread a thin layer of tomato sauce over the top.
Evenly distribute the turkey pepperoni slices on top of the sauce and sprinkle fresh basil over the pizza.
Return the pizza to the oven for an additional 5-7 minutes until the toppings are heated through and the cheese is melted.
Remove from the oven, slice, and serve immediately.
